This problem happens once in a while. It can go 2 months without problem. Next week it happens 3 times. Fuel pump changed 2 times in past 2 months. 2 mechanics and a Ford dealer have not come up with a solution.

Did they change the rubber hoses on the tank top and sock filter when they changed the pump? If the service writer didn't write it down, a dealer mechanic is not usually authorized to do it. If the old sock filter was massively dirty, did they flush the tank or replace it if rusty?
